The Electricity Company of Ghana, ECG has successfully tracked and retrieved over 1,000 of containers flagged as missing earlier this year. Minister for Energy and Green Transition John Jinapor had announced the containers which ECG cables at the Tema Port could not be accounted for. The development triggered a national security investigations with the minister later informing parliament the investigative report had been forwarded to the Attorney-General for action.
But addressing members of the Energy Committee of Parliament acting Managing Director of the Electricity Company of Ghana (ECG), Julius Kpekpena, revealed that the company has successfully retrieved over 1,000 containers that went missing earlier this year.
Mr. Kpekpena also disclosed that ECG has cancelled more than 200 contracts as part of its ongoing reforms.
